Key Components in Solar Panel Manufacturing
Solar panel production involves selecting premium materials and applying precise engineering methods to ensure efficiency, durability, and peak performance. Every component has a critical role in capturing sunlight and maintaining the panel’s reliability over time. Here are the key components used in solar panel manufacturing:
- Solar Cells: These components, crafted from silicon varieties such as monocrystalline, polycrystalline, or thin-film, work to convert sunlight into electricity. Precision machining of silicon wafers ensures better consistency and optimized energy production, enhancing both performance and reliability over time.
- Encapsulation Layers: EVA (ethylene vinyl acetate) acts as a protective layer for solar cells, guarding them against moisture and mechanical damage, while also ensuring maximum light transmission for optimal energy output.
- Tempered Glass Panels: Safeguard solar cells from environmental factors like hail and UV rays. Proper alignment with encapsulation layers is essential to ensure the panel’s durability and long-lasting performance.
- Backsheet: Polymer-based materials like PET provide a weatherproof barrier and structural stability to protect the internal components.
- Aluminum Frames: Aluminum’s lightweight and corrosion-resistant properties make it the ideal choice for framing solar panels. Precision CNC cutting allows for exact alignment of connection points, ensuring strong, secure assembly and maximizing durability over time.
- Junction Box and Wiring: Copper wiring and durable plastics work together to manage electrical flow. With precision machining, the components are perfectly sealed, preventing water ingress and ensuring long-term reliability.
- Mounting Systems: Steel or aluminum are commonly used in mounting systems, providing durability and proper panel alignment for optimal sunlight exposure. Precision craftsmanship is critical for ensuring the highest efficiency levels.

Here’s why precision machining plays a crucial role in solar panel production:
- Increasing Power Efficiency: Even minor flaws in components such as frames, mounts, and connectors can affect energy conversion. Precision machining guarantees every part fits perfectly, reducing energy loss and enhancing solar power generation.
- Increasing Structural Resilience: Solar panels endure extreme weather, including high winds and heavy snow. Precision-engineered mounts, brackets, and supports enhance durability and stability, safeguarding against mechanical failures and ensuring long-term performance.
- Enhancing Electrical Efficiency: To maintain optimal conductivity and reduce resistance, solar panel components must be expertly machined. Faulty parts can lead to inefficiencies, overheating, or system failure, which impacts overall energy output.
- Minimizing Production Defects: In large-scale solar panel production, precision machining minimizes variability and ensures that parts meet tight tolerances. This consistency reduces defects, improves quality control, and ultimately cuts down on costs and production delays.
- Maximizing Panel Lifespan: Precision machining helps ensure that solar panels last for 25–30 years by providing high-quality components that seamlessly integrate, reducing wear and tear and lowering maintenance requirements throughout their lifetime.
